Mr. Barr introduced the following bill; which was referred to the Committee on Financial Services, Additional sponsors: Mr. Gottheimer, Mr. Sessions, Mr. Davidson, Mr. Moskowitz, Mr. Moore of North Carolina, and Mr. Lawler, Reported with an amendment, committed to the Committee of the Whole House on the State of the Union, and ordered to be printed
To require the Board of Governors of the Federal Reserve System, the Comptroller of the Currency, and the Federal Deposit Insurance Corporation to study how partnerships between fintechs and banking organizations can support new banking organization formation and community bank health, and for other purposes.
